What a Tensioned Material Sail In Fact Does
A sail looks easy, which is part of the appeal, but it is doing a number of tasks at once. At the most standard level, Custom-made HDPE shade fabric structures block ultraviolet radiation, typically in the 90 to 98 percent range depending on color and weave. The yarns are stabilized to handle Arizona's unrelenting UV exposure, and the knitted building lets wind bleed through while holding a crisp catenary edge. That breathable quality is why well-designed Commercial playground shade covers feel cooler than strong roof panels.
An effectively tensioned membrane sheds monsoon rain efficiently without pooling. The low and high accessory points produce a hyperbolic surface that keeps water moving and makes the material read as sculpture. On a hectic swimming pool deck or an outdoor dining establishment outdoor patio, the sail's geometry becomes part of the area planning. Keep flow paths high and open, drop the leeward corner where you want shade concentrated, and you get a livable space in what used to be an oven.
From an engineering viewpoint, a sail is a pre-stressed surface area moving loads to poles https://architectural-shade-structuresheez458.cavandoragh.org/playground-shade-structures-in-arizona-keep-kids-cool-and-safe and footings. The fabric is not a tarpaulin, it is a structural component that desires uniform, well balanced tension. That is why Industrial shade structure engineering services matter more than the color chart. If the take-off and attachment heights are incorrect, you will go after wrinkles and water pockets for years.

Why Arizona Demands a Various Spec
A sail that would survive a seaside climate may not last in Phoenix or Yuma without modifications. UV levels are amongst the highest in the continental U.S., and monsoon storms bring short, violent gusts that penalize loose materials. Arizona code-compliant shade structures typically develop to wind speeds in the 105 to 120 mph variety depending upon county. Snow loads are minimal in the low desert however matter in Flagstaff and Payson. The winning formula blends hard HDPE or PVC-coated polyester for the membrane, correctly sized steel with conservative deflection limits, and deep footings that reach qualified soil beneath landscaped fill.
Hardware selection plays a huge function. Marine-grade stainless for turnbuckles and shackles prevents staining and takes less when adjusted during upkeep. Powder coat systems in light colors help in reducing heat soak on poles that kids might touch, while textured finishes hide dings in busy environments. The best Business shade structure professionals Phoenix understand where alkaline soils are most likely to attack ingrained steel, and specify wraps or cathodic protection accordingly.

Choosing In between 3‑Point, 4‑Point, and Hybrids
Custom shade sail style and installation boils down to form geometry and support strategy. Three-point sails are efficient and sophisticated. With 3 corners you always get a real saddle surface with a clear high point and low point, that makes drain and de-tensioning habits foreseeable. The trade-off is protection near the edges, where triangular shapes can leave sunny wedges. Custom 3‑point shade sails for industrial usage stand out as accents, over entries, or where several sails can overlap like scales.
Four-point sails expand coverage and handle rectangle-shaped patios or play area footprints well. A 4‑point hyperbolic shade cruises setup produces that signature twist, which looks architectural and assists with water shedding. Because 2 corners need to be higher and 2 lower, anticipate more varied pole heights, which can be a plus for drama or an obstacle for sightlines. On sports courts or long dining balconies, we typically release a rhythm of rotating low and high that keeps the structure from checking out monotonous.
Hybrids and layers take this even more. We may pair a large 4‑point main sail with two smaller triangles beneath, rotated 20 to 30 degrees. This stacks shade density where heat load peaks and offers brand colors a possibility to interaction. Big period industrial shade structures often utilize cable edges with fabric panels tensioned in between. The look is tight and thin, terrific when you require a huge clear area without large trusses.
Fabric, Color, and Heat
Color choice is not just looks. Lighter tones reflect more visible light, which can suggest a cooler feel straight under the canopy. Darker tones often block more UV and glare, which can reduce eyestrain and make gadget screens more understandable. In practice, a premium UV obstructing material shade structure in sandstone or light gray will feel a little cooler than one in navy, but the distinction is normally a couple of degrees. I encourage hospitality clients to focus on guest convenience and photography, and schools to focus on glare control where students read or utilize tablets outdoors.
For Commercial grade pool deck shade, we stick to knitted HDPE the majority of the time. It tidies up well with low-pressure washing and does not trap heat the method non-breathable PVC membranes can. Architectural tensile structures Arizona that require weather-tight coverage, such as amphitheaters or market halls, tilt toward PVC-coated polyester with bonded seams and keder edges. The membrane choice drives detailing and maintenance schedules, so choose early based upon use patterns and desired life cycle.
Poles, Footings, and the Covert Work
Anchorage is where budgets often explode or jobs shine for decades. A modest 20 by 20 foot sail can pull several thousands of pounds at each corner when the wind strikes. In poor fill, that might equate to 24 to 36 inch diameter piers, 8 to 12 feet deep with significant rebar cages. On tight outdoor patios, this means coordinated saw cutting, hand digging around energies, and pour backs that match existing surfaces. It is the unglamorous part of customized cantilever shade setup, but it determines whether your sails remain tight and quiet.
Custom shade canopy manufacturing tolerances matter too. We represent initial stretch, specify enhanced corner spots, and use cable television border edges where suitable. I have actually seen more affordable imports where corners rip within one season since the plate and webbing style might not distribute load. The delta between a well-built membrane and a bargain one is not just fabric weight, it is stitch density, thread type, and corner architecture.
Lifecycle, Repair works, and Fabric Replacement
All structures age in the sun. The normal life span for top quality HDPE sails in Arizona ranges from 8 to 12 years, in some cases 15 with conscientious care and protected orientation. During that time, regular checks keep problems little. We manage Existing shade structure upkeep Arizona for shopping mall and districts with an easy cycle: seasonal evaluations for hardware looseness, material tension checks, and quick-wash cleaning to eliminate dust that abrades yarns. If you see flutter in a storm, you are currently late to adjust.
When membranes reach the end of life, Industrial shade material replacement is straightforward if the steel stays sound. We pattern off the old sail, verify corner locations and heights, and manufacture brand-new fabric to fit existing attachment points. Shade structure canopy repair work professionals can likewise Change torn shade structure material after a wind event, offered the tear has actually not propagated into load-critical zones. Maintenance Rhythms That Extend Life
Set a cadence. Quarterly visual checks throughout peak season catch loose turnbuckles and used shackles before they become tears. Post-storm walkthroughs to eliminate sharp particles from material pockets and re-tune stress avoid chafing. Annual cleaning keeps dust from acting like sandpaper on fibers. If you operate a resort or retail center, train your facilities group on safe changes and keep a little package on hand.
When the time comes, do not wait for failure. Arrange Commercial shade material replacement in the off-season. For schools, late May and early June are best windows. For hotels, coordinate around shoulder periods or prepared restorations. It takes forethought, but it keeps you out of emergency situation mode and protects brand consistency.
